What a 'net worth' figure actually includes (and how these estimates get made)

Net worth, in the strict sense, is total assets minus total liabilities. For a public company executive or athlete with disclosed contracts, you can build a reasonable estimate from salary records, endorsement deals, property records, and business equity. For private individuals like Marquis Taylor the sports agent or Marcus Taylor the Lazard MD, none of those inputs are publicly disclosed, which means every number you see online is modeled or guessed.

Celebrity net worth sites typically estimate by combining known salary benchmarks for a given industry tier, public property records where available, and sometimes social media follower counts run through monetization formulas. One site in particular, PeopleAI, publishes figures in the hundreds of millions for various 'Marcus Taylor' profiles while including a disclaimer that their numbers are estimations based on social factors and Instagram monetization programs. That disclaimer matters: those figures are not financial documents and should not be taken as real wealth estimates.

CelebrityHow lists a '$5 million' figure for a Marcus Taylor. ContactOut, which scrapes professional profiles, shows a range of $2,500 to $24,999 for the Marcus Taylor connected to Gray Construction's VP role. The gap between those two figures alone shows you how little consensus or rigor exists across these sources. Treat every third-party estimate as a starting point for your own research, not a final answer. Marquis Taylor, NBA sports agent

Marquis Taylor founded Mogul Sports Group in 2008 and has been an NBPA-certified agent since 2014, also holding FIBA certification for international player contracts. Sports agents typically earn 3 to 4 percent of player contracts they negotiate. A mid-tier agent with a modest roster of NBA and international players could realistically generate $200,000 to $1 million or more annually, depending on the value of contracts under management. Mogul Sports Group has operated for over 15 years, which means compounding income and potential equity in the business itself. That said, no public filing documents Marquis Taylor's personal compensation or the firm's revenue, so any specific net worth figure is an informed estimate at best.

What common mistake do people make when converting salary benchmarks into a net worth estimate?

No, because net worth is not the same as annual income. If you see a figure derived from salary alone, it may ignore taxes, living expenses, debt, and investment performance. A practical sanity check is to compare the implied annual take-home versus the career timeline length (for example, whether the numbers would require savings far beyond typical compensation).

If I want to build my own defensible “marcus taylor net worth” range, what quick method should I use?

Use a two-step range method: (1) build a plausible annual income range from the role using career stage, then (2) apply a conservative savings and investment assumption to convert income into likely net worth, with a tax and fee haircut. This prevents a single optimistic assumption from inflating the final result.
